Montgomery has prototypical right field tools with plus raw power as a switch hitter and a 70-grade arm that should make runners think twice about taking an extra bag. He's better as a lefthanded hitter and did have a late-season ankle injury, though that should be more of a brief issue.
Montgomery is now one of five Boston prospects on the list, with the "Big Three" of Marcelo Mayer (No. 10), Roman Anthony (No. 18), and Kyle Teel (No. 31) at the top of the rankings.
The 21-year-old put up impressive numbers in his final college season, batting .322 with 85 RBIs and 27 home runs.
While it may be a while until Montgomery is up with the big-league team, he seems to have a lot of promise that Red Sox fans should be excited about.
